CVE-2007-5225

Integer signedness error in FIFO filesystems (named pipes) on Sun Solaris 8 through 10 allows local users to read the contents of unspecified memory locations via a negative maximum length value to the I_PEEK ioctl.

Published: October 04, 2007; 8:17:00 PM -0400
V3.x:(not available)
V2.0: 4.9 MEDIUM
CVE-2007-4310

The finger daemon (in.fingerd) in Sun Solaris 7 through 9 allows remote attackers to list all accounts that have certain nonstandard GECOS fields via a request composed of a single digit, as demonstrated by a "finger 9@host" command, a different vulnerability than CVE-2001-1503.

Published: August 13, 2007; 5:17:00 PM -0400
V3.x:(not available)
V2.0: 4.3 MEDIUM

CVE-2006-7140

The libike library, as used by in.iked, elfsign, and kcfd in Sun Solaris 9 and 10, when using an RSA key with exponent 3, removes PKCS-1 padding before generating a hash, which allows remote attackers to forge a PKCS #1 v1.5 signature that is signed by that RSA key and prevents libike from correctly verifying X.509 and other certificates that use PKCS #1, a similar issue to CVE-2006-4339.

Published: March 07, 2007; 3:19:00 PM -0500
V3.x:(not available)
V2.0: 5.8 MEDIUM
